On January 11, Beijing time, after yesterday's fiasco to the Grizzlies, the Lakers' record has fallen to 21 wins and 20 losses, ranking seventh in the West, according to the current performance of the Lakers, not to mention the impact of the championship, and even the playoff seats are difficult to guarantee. At present, the biggest problem with the Lakers is that James is too tired, playing more than 37 minutes on the court, and no one can stand up and score at the end of the break, and finally the game collapses.

With the trade deadline of the season approaching, the Lakers need to strengthen the lineup through trades. In this regard, the famous Magician Johnson also talked about the current situation of the Lakers: "The Lakers can't rely too much on James and thick eyebrows now, they need to have a third person to stand up, they need to get a player who can score 15-18 points every game, which is also what Pelinka has to consider when making a trade." ”

According to reporter Shams, the Lakers are pursuing the Pistons' Jerami Grant, in addition to which they have developed a very strong interest in Miles Turner and are further approaching the two to try to complete the deal. The two men's playing style is also very much in line with the Lakers' current lineup.

First of all, Grant is a forward player, the 27-year-old has played 24 games for the Pistons in this game, averaging 33 minutes per game, can get 20.1 points + 4.8 rebounds + 2.6 assists + 1.1 steals + 1.1 blocks, not only can attack with the ball, but also play without the ball, and the efficiency on the defensive end is also at the forefront of the league, which is the front player that the Lakers urgently need. At present, the Pistons have put it on the shelf, in addition to the Lakers, the Wizards, Knicks, and Blazers also have interest grant.

Miles Turner, on the other hand, is a space-based interior player who has played in 39 games for the Pacers this season, averaging 30 minutes per game and can get a stat of 13.1 points, 7.3 rebounds, 1.1 assists and 2.9 blocks, and shooting 35.7% from three-point range. While being able to shoot from the outside, it can also protect the frame on the inside, whether it is with James or the thick eyebrow brother is very suitable. In addition to the Lakers, the Lone Rangers, Knicks, and Hornets also have a sense of Turner.
